titleOfInvention |
Method of preparing agent with antiopisthorchiasis effect |
abstract |
FIELD: medicine. SUBSTANCE: aspen milled bark is extracted with water at 70 C in the ratio of components raw : water = (1:8)-(1:10), infused for 4-6 h, squeezed out and extract is settled for 2-4 h followed by concentrating under vacuum at 30-50 C up to 60 wt.%. Then residue is extracted with 45% ethyl alcohol in the ratio of components 1:1 for 4-6 h, squeezed out and aqueous and alcoholic extracts are combined followed by evaporation and drying under vacuum. EFFECT: increased yield and specific activity of agent, improved organoleptic properties. 2 ex |
